Timor-Leste Follows the Competency-Based Medical Education (CBME) Curriculum

The major benefit for Indian Students planning for MBBS in Timor Leste is that the curriculum follows the Competency-Based Medical Education (CBME) framework.

Competency-Based Medical Education is the same curriculum model currently followed in all medical colleges of India. The main objective of offering this curriculum is basically to ensure students get accurate exposure. Students get to develop practical competencies, communication skills, ethical values, clinical reasoning abilities, and patient-centered medical knowledge throughout their education.

Apart from India, very few countries have adopted the CBME framework comprehensively. Timor-Leste stands among the select destinations that have aligned their medical education system with this modern approach.

CBME curriculum is approved by the country’s accrediting authority. The curriculum offers students with progressive learning environment starting from the basic sciences till advanced clinical training.


Structured Academic Progression Through Credit-Based Learning

The Timor-Leste MBBS curriculum is organized through a structured credit-based system that gradually develops a student's knowledge and clinical competencies.

The initial years focus on foundational medical sciences such as:
•    Anatomy
•    Physiology
•    Biochemistry
•    Histology
•    Embryology
•    Community Medicine

As students’ progress through the program, the curriculum transitions toward:
•    Pathology
•    Pharmacology
•    Microbiology
•    Forensic Medicine
•    Surgery
•    Internal Medicine
•    Pediatrics
•    Obstetrics and Gynecology

A significant portion of the later years is dedicated to clinical rotations, where students gain hands-on experience in hospitals and healthcare facilities under faculty supervision.

This gradual progression ensures that students build a strong theoretical foundation before entering clinical practice.


Family Adoption Program: A Unique Feature of Timor-Leste MBBS Curriculum

An innovative yet unique feature of Timor Leste MBBS Curriculum is its “Family Adoption Program”. It is a unique learning experience provided to students in order to gain more of clinical exposure. 

Starting from the second year itself of MBBS Program, students are divided into small group of students approx. 20-25 and are assigned a specific village. The village becomes their designated learning community throughout the program.

MBBS Students are expected to Interact with families on daily basis, know their healthcare needs, monitor the diseases and promote preventive healthcare practices. As a part of their learning, students learn and understand the social determinants of health that eventually help them in future.

This impressive approach helps students develop a deeper understanding of public health, preventive medicine, and primary healthcare delivery.


Clinical Logbook Training Begins from the Second Year 

Another remarkable aspect included in Timor Leste MBBS Curriculum is the introduction of “Clinical Logbook Documentation”. From second year of MBBS Onwards, students are mandated to maintain a detailed clinical logbook to record their daily learning.

Clinical Logbook Includes:
•    Patient Cases Observed
•    Clinical Findings
•    Procedures Performed
•    Practical Skills Acquired
•    Laboratory Activities
•    Learning Outcomes
•    Faculty Observations
•    Faculty Signatures

MBBS aspirants are required to note down the duration of clinical encounters, diagnostics approaches, and treatment on each learning experience. This unique system of Timor Leste promotes accountability and helps in continuous learning of students.
